The Socorro Independent School District Community Education Program will host information sessions, interviews and testing for adults interested in the pharmacy technician program at 3 p.m. Sept. 25 in Options High School at 12380 Pine Springs.

Classes will begin Oct. 18 from 3 to 8:30 p.m. Mondays and Wednesdays.

Requirements for class eligibility include a high school diploma or GED and intermediate English reading and math levels as determined by issued testing (TABE 11/12 test).

Candidates that meet eligibility will be contacted for a registration intake at 3 p.m. Oct. 2.
